Duties and Responsibilities

As Membership Executive, I will assume full responsibility for the efficient operation in the following:

  • Act as a primary point of contact for members, responding promptly and professionally to inquiries, requests, and feedback.
  • Assist with onboarding new members, ensuring they feel welcomed and informed about the benefits, events, and community ethos.
  • Support the coordination and communication of member events, activities, and experiences.
  • Build and maintain positive relationships with members, ensuring a warm, personalized, and consistent level of service.
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date member records in the CRM system (PeopleVine).
  • Prepare reports and data summaries for the Membership Manager, including engagement metrics, renewals, and event participation.
  • Process membership applications, renewals, and payments in line with policy.
  • Assist in the development and distribution of membership communications and promotional materials.
  • Support event logistics and ensure smooth coordination between internal teams and members.
  • Attend departmental meetings and provide updates on member feedback, trends, and opportunities for improvement.

Qualifications

To execute the position of Membership Executive, I must have the required qualifications, technical skills and experience in a similar role in luxury environments with proven results and includes the following:

  • Diploma or Bachelor's degree in Hospitality, Business Administration, or related field.
  • Minimum 1–2 years of experience in guest relations, membership services, or front-of-house operations (preferably in luxury hospitality).
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ills, with a natural ability to build rapport.
  • Good administrative and organizational skills, with attention to detail.
  • Proficiency in MS Office (Word, Excel, Outlook, PowerPoint) and familiarity with CRM systems (PeopleVine experience is an advantage).
  • Excellent spoken and written English; knowledge of additional languages is an advantage.
  • Positive attitude, adaptability, and passion for wellness and sustainability.
